Устройство для контроля последовательного кода
Иллюстрации
Показать всеРеферат
Изобретение относится к автоматике и вычислительной технике и может быть использовано для контроля передачи данных по каналу связи. Цель . изобретения - повышение диагностической способности устройства. Перед началом работы триггер 1 и счетчик 2 устанавливаются соответственно в единичное и нулевое состояния. На информационный вход 8 устройства поступает передаваемая информация, которая проходит на счетный вход триггера 1, выход которого соединен с первыми входами всех элементов И первой группы 3. На входе 12 контрольного разряда устройства постоянно присутствует контрольный разряд слова, который заводится на первые входы всех элементов И второй группы 4. По окончании передачи слова стробирующий с входа 11 устройства добавляет единицу к счетчику 2 и поступает на вход элемента задержки 5, выход которого соединен с вторыми входами всех элементов И групп 3 и 4 Выход счетчика 2 соединен с входом адреса дешифратора 6, выходы которого соединены с третьими входами соответствующих элементов И групп 3 и 4. По задержанному стробирующему сигналу происходит опрос соответствующих элементов И групп 3 и 4 и сигналы с их выходов сравниваются соответствующим узлом сравнения группы 7. При несравнении формируется сигнал на соответствующем выходе группы 13 выходов признаков ошибки устройства. 1 ил. (Л со со о со 05
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К
А1
09) 01) 5ц 4 С 06 F ll!10
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(21) 4015257/24-24 (22) 22.01 .86 (46) 23.06.87. Бюл. М 23 (72) В.И.Гребенников (53) 681.3(088.8) (56) Авторское свидетельство СССР
Р 530332, кл. G 06 Р 11/10, 197А.
Авторское свидетельство СССР
Р 1103239, кл. G 06 Р 11/10, 1983. (54) УСТРОЙСТВО ДЛЯ КОНТРОЛИ IIOCJIEPOВАТЕЛЬНОГО КОДА (57) Изобретение относится к автоматике и вычислительной технике и может быть использовано для контроля передачи данных по каналу связи. 1)ель .изобретения — повьппение диагностической способности устройства. Перед началом работы триггер 1 и счетчик 2 устанавливаются соответственно в единичное и нулевое состояния. На информационный вход 8 устройства поступает передаваемая информация, которая проходит на счетный вход триггера 1, выход которого соединен с первыми входами всех элементов И первой группы 3. На входе 12 контрольного разряда устройства постоянно присутствует контрольный разряд слова, который заводится на первые входы всех элементов И второй группы 4. По окончании передачи слова стробирующий сигнал с входа 11 устройства добавляет единицу к счетчику 2 и поступает на вход элемента задержки 5, выход которого соединен с вторыми входами всех элементов И групп 3 и 4с Выход счетчика 2 соединен с входом адреса дешифратора 6, выходы которого соединены с третьими входами соответствую- щих элементов И групп 3 и 4. По задержанному стробирующему сигналу происходит опрос соответствующих элементов И групп 3 и 4 и сигналы с их вы-. ходов сравниваются соответствующим узлом сравнения группы 7. При несравнении формируется сигнал на соответствующем выходе группы 13 выходов признаков ошибки устройства. 1 ил.
1319036
Изобретение относится к автоматике и вычислительной технике и может быть использовано для контроля передачи данных по каналу связи.
Целью изобретения является повыше- 5 ние диагностической способности устройства.
На чертеже приведена функциональная схема устройства, Устройство для контроля последова- О тельного кода, содержи триггер 1, счетчик 2, первую 3 и вторую 4 группы элементов И, элемент 5 задержки, дешифратор 6,. группу 7 узлов сравнения, информационный вход 8 устройства, установочные входы 9 и 10 устройства, стробирующий вход Il устройства, вход 12 контрольного разряда устройства,.группу 13 выходов признака ошибки устройства. Кроме того, на чертеже обозначен блок 14 сопряжения с каналами связи, который не входит в состав устройства.
Из блока 14 сопряжения с каналами
25 связи поступают следующие сигналы: на информационный вход 8 устройства— последовательность информационного кода, поступающая в канал связи; на первый установочный вход 9 устройства — сигнал начала каждого слова в информационном сообщении; на второй установочный вход 10 устройства = сигнал начала информационного сообщения; на стробирующий вход 11 устройства — сигнал окончания каждого 35 слова в информационном сообщении; на вход 12 контрольного разряда устройства — сигнал свертки по модулю два для каждого слова, который присутствует на время выдачи соответствующего информационного слова.
Счетчик 2 служит для подсчета количества слов в сообщении.
Элемент 5 задержки предназначен для компенсации переходных процессов в счетчике 2.
Информация, выдаваемая из блока
14 сопряжения в канал связи, поступает также и в устройство через информационный вход 8. 50
Устройство работает следующим образом.
Перед выдачей информации из блока
14 сопряжения на первый и второй установочные входы 9 и 10 устройства поступают сигналы, которые устанавливают соответственно триггер 1 в
"1", а счетчик 2 — в "0"., на вход 12 контрольного разряда устройства поступает сигнал свертки по модулю два, который сохраняет свое значение на время выдачи слова, Последовательность импульсов информационного сообщения поступает на счетный вход триггера 1, причем, если количество импульсов в слове четное, то триггер устанавливается в "
"ll" если нечетное — то в "0". По окончании каждого слова на счетный вход счетчика 2 поступает стробирующий сигнал. Таким образом, счетчик 2 подсчитывает количество слов в сообщении. Сигнал окончания слова стробирующего входа 11 устройства поступает также через элемент 5 задержки на третьи входы всех элементов И первой
3 и второй 4 групп.
Допустим, что количество импуль- 1 сов в слове четное, тогда на выходе триггера 1 присутствует сигнал "1", который поступает на первые входы всех элементов И первой группы 3.
На первых входах всех элементов И второй группы 4 присутствует сигнал свертки по модулю два для данного слова, поступающий с входа 12 контрольного разряда устройства. На одном из выходов дешифратора 6 устанавливается положительный потенциал, соответствующий контрольному слову сообщения, который поступает на вторые входы соответствующих элементов И первой 3 и второй 4 групп. На третьи входы элементов И первой 3 и второй групп с элемента 5 задержки поступает управляющий сигнал. Сигнал с элемента И первой группы 3 поступает на первый вход соответствующего узла сравнения группы 7, где сравнивается с сигналом, поступающим на его второй вход с соответствующего элемента
И второй группы 4.
В случае искажения выходной последовательности импульсов в слове на выходе узла сравнения группы 7, соответствующего данному слову, появляется сигнал ошибки.
Аналогично проверяется каждое слово сообщения.
Пословный контроль передаваемой информации позволяет установить место ошибки и, если это необходимо, повторить ошибочное слово. .Ф о р м у л а и з о б р е т е н и я
Устройство для контроля последова" тельного кода, содержащее триггер, элемент задержки и две группы элемен1319036
Составитель В. Гречнев
Редактор О. Бугир Техред И.Попович Корректор Л. Пилипенко
Тираж 672 Подписное
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Заказ 2514/44
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 тов И, о т л и ч а ю щ е е с я тем, что, с целью повышения диагностической способности устройства, в него введены счетчик, дешифратор и группа узлов сравнения, причем единичный вход триггера является первым установочным входом устройства, счетный вход триггера является информационным .входом устройства, вход сброса счетчика является вторым установоч- 10 ным входом устройства, вход элемента задержки объединен.со счетным входом счетчика и является стробирующим входом устройства, прямой выход триггера соединен с первыми входами всех 15 элементов И первой группы выходы ко/ торых соединены с первыми информационными входами соответствующих узлов сравнения группы, выходы Равно ко-!! !! торых образуют группу выходов признака ошибки устройства, первые входы всех элементов И второй группы объединены и образуют вход контрольного разряда устройства, выход элемента задержки соединен с вторыми входами всех элементов И первой и второй групп, разрядные выходы счетчика соединены с информационными входами дешифратора, выходы которого соединены с третьими входами соответствующих элементов И первой и второй групп, выходы элементов И второй группы соединены с вторыми информационными входами соответствующих узлов сравнения группы.